Juncus balticus Willdenow ssp. littoralis (Engelmann) Snogerup. Subgenus: Agathryon. Section: Juncotypus. Common name: Baltic Rush. Phenology: May-Oct. Habitat: Open calcareous wetlands (fens), prairies. Distribution: The species is circumboreal; ssp. littoralis is North American: NL (Labrador) west to BC, south to NY (Long Island), NJ, PA, w. VA, OH, IN, MO, and KS.
ID notes: Of our members of section Genuini (species with a lateral inflorescence), Juncus balticus ssp. littoralis can be distinguished by its acute capsules, stout creeping rhizome, dark perianth, and upwardly sweeping inflorescence branches.
Origin/Endemic status: Native

Wetland Indicator Status:
- Atlantic and Gulf Coastal Plain: OBL (name change)
- Eastern Mountains and Piedmont: OBL (name change)
- Great Plains: FACW (name change)
- Midwest: OBL (name change)
- Northcentral & Northeast: OBL (name change)
